Возможен ли поисковый фильтр Gmail «от: контакты»?


10

В Gmail мы можем фильтровать наш поисковый запрос по одному контакту (Джон Смит) с помощью фильтра search-term from: johnsmith@gmail.com.

Есть ли возможность изменить фильтр поиска для всех моих контактов, а не только для одного контакта?

Ответы:


5

Самая близкая вещь, которую я могу найти среди продвинутых операторов поиска Gmail - это has:circleоператор.

Поиск всех сообщений, которые были отправлены кем-то, кого вы добавили в свои круги Google+

Пример: has:circle

Значение: любое сообщение, отправленное пользователем в любом из ваших кругов.

Так что, если все ваши контакты в круге Google+, это будет работать для вас. К сожалению, нет is:contactоператора.


Тьфу. G + и G-Mail не одно и то же.
Майкл Паукуонис

@ Майкл: Да, я знаю это. Но круги G + теперь отображаются в ваших контактах. Виноват гугл.
Але

О да, не виноват. Хотя мне нравится G +, меня все еще раздражает то, как Google пытается навязать нам это, особенно когда это неуместно.
Майкл Паукуонис

Ну, они больше не навязывают это нам. Они совсем не связаны между собой.
Але

4

По сути, вы не можете. Для gmail такого фильтра подстановки или оператора поиска не существует. Список действительных операторов поиска в Gmail можно найти здесь: http://support.google.com/mail/bin/answer.py?hl=ru&answer=7190 .

Один парень в Webapps спросил обратное ( почта из контактов НЕ в адресной книге ). Он тоже не мог этого сделать.

Я не нашел ничего, чтобы решить вашу проблему:

  • Сторонние поисковые приложения (не разрешены)
  • Почтовые клиенты для настольных компьютеров (например, Outlook) с надстройками. РЕДАКТИРОВАТЬ: Thunderbird действительно может это сделать (вам даже не нужна надстройка)
  • в Gmail Labs.

Если это возможно, вам, вероятно, придется создать его самостоятельно (макрос Outlook или скрипт Greasemonkey).


1

Вы можете сгруппировать все свои контакты в группу контактов и выполнить фильтрацию по группе контактов в Gmail. Это требует знания Python, однако. Ниже приведен код Python:

original = '[insert email addresses copied from the contact group]'
replaceComma = original.replace(",", " OR")
result = re.sub(r'".*?"', '', replaceComma)
print result

Ваша ссылка теперь ведет на страницу с рекламой для взрослых.
Йонска

1

Вы можете сделать фильтр в этом формате:

from:({"Katherine Jones" <katherine@Jones.com>, "Stan Jones" <stan@jones.com>, etc…})

Я помещаю все адреса в Word и редактирую их, чтобы получить такой формат. Ограничение состоит в том, что он может занимать только очень много адресов на фильтр, поэтому у меня есть фильтр для имен AD, еще один фильтр для EK и т. Д. Я не знаю, сколько символов это займет, но поместил их все в и ошибка покажет вам ограничение. Затем разделите ваши адреса на блоки, чтобы соответствовать этому ограничению. Я получаю около 25 адресов / фильтр.


Upvoted как добавление фигурных скобок делает свое дело. Вы можете добавить нужные контакты в группу, затем отфильтровать ее и добавить квадратные скобки, чтобы применить фильтр к любому письму в наборе.
MCMZL

0

я полагаю, что

-has:circle

исключит всю электронную почту из аккаунтов, не входящих в ваш круг


FWIW, этот поиск работает в окне поиска для поиска почты, но не в поле from: для правил фильтрации. Я пытаюсь сделать это сейчас, заканчивая тем, что просто добавляю людей, которых хочу добавить в белый список.
Крис К

0

Если вам действительно нужна эта функция, вы можете загрузить электронную почту с помощью Thunderbird.

Thunderbird может фильтровать по адресной книге, и вы можете иметь несколько адресных книг.

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.